CAS 394-31-0
:5-Hydroxyanthranilic acid
Description:
5-Hydroxyanthranilic acid is an organic compound that belongs to the class of amino acids and is a derivative of anthranilic acid. It is characterized by the presence of a hydroxyl group (-OH) at the 5-position of the anthranilic acid structure, which contributes to its solubility in water and its reactivity. This compound is typically a white to pale yellow crystalline solid and is known for its role in the biosynthesis of the neurotransmitter serotonin and the metabolism of tryptophan. It exhibits various biological activities, including antioxidant properties and potential involvement in cellular signaling pathways. 5-Hydroxyanthranilic acid can also participate in the formation of complex structures with metal ions, which may have implications in biological systems and therapeutic applications. Its CAS number, 394-31-0, is used for identification in chemical databases and regulatory contexts. Overall, this compound is of interest in both biochemical research and potential pharmaceutical applications due to its diverse functional properties.
